PERFORMANS
| Öğe | Metalized Polyester |
| Capacitance Drift | Cycled through the operating temperature range 2%. |
| Humidity Test | Will withstand the test of R.H. 95% at 40°C for 1000hrs. C < 5% DF < 1.2% VE > 10000MΩ |
| Load Test | Will withstand a testing voltage at 140% of W.V. for 1000hrs at 85°C. C < 5% DF < 1.2% VE > 5000MΩ |
| Lead Pull Test | Will withstand a pull of 1.5Kg applied axialy for 10 saniye. |
|
Lead Bend Test |
Will sustain two cycles without breaking when attaching a load of 0.5Kg to the end of the lead and then rotating the capacitor 90º from the direction of lead egress. Then 180 in opposite direction, then back to the starting point. |
| Solderability | Immersed in molten solder (230 + 0.5 sec.) after testing, the wound lead and gap in the wound lead will be covered and filled by solder. Will be difficult to unwind byfinger. |
| Dielectric Strength | Shall withstand 200% veya 160% of rated voltage at 25°C for 1 minute with current limiting resistance of 1 Ah
/ V. |
